Graduation ceremonies for bachelor鈥檚 and master鈥檚 degree graduates to be standardised
911爆料网 is standardising the graduation days of bachelor鈥檚 and master鈥檚 degree students, as of 31 December 2019. From that date onwards, graduation will be possible every month of the year in all Aalto schools, giving students an opportunity to make full use of the academic year.
